Ying Zhong is a scholar working on Ocean Engineering, Mechanical Engineering and Mechanics of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Ying Zhong has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 351 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 20 papers in Ocean Engineering, 18 papers in Mechanical Engineering and 13 papers in Mechanics of Materials. Recurrent topics in Ying Zhong’s work include Hydraulic Fracturing and Reservoir Analysis (18 papers), Drilling and Well Engineering (16 papers) and Hydrocarbon exploration and reservoir analysis (8 papers). Ying Zhong is often cited by papers focused on Hydraulic Fracturing and Reservoir Analysis (18 papers), Drilling and Well Engineering (16 papers) and Hydrocarbon exploration and reservoir analysis (8 papers). Ying Zhong collaborates with scholars based in China, Canada and United States. Ying Zhong's co-authors include Hao Zhang, Jiping She, Ergün Kuru, Yin Feng, Bin Yang, Jie Zheng, Yang Yan, Hui Mao, Yongchun Zhang and Hao Zhang and has published in prestigious journals such as Chemical Engineering Journal, Fuel and Nanotechnology.
